BRONTE, TEXAS QUICK STATSCounty: Coke
Elevation: 1797 feet
Land Area: 1.44 square miles
Population Density: 679 people per square mile
Population: 977
Races (City): White Non-Hispanic (79.2%), Hispanic (20.1%), Other race (8.6%), Two or more races (1.1%) (Total can be greater than 100% because Hispanics could be counted in other races)
Ancestries (City): United States (17.9%), Irish (12.2%), German (12.0%), English (7.2%), French (2.7%), Scottish (2.0%)
Nearest city with pop. 50,000+: San Angelo, TX (31.4 miles , pop. 88,439)
Nearest city with pop. 200,000+: Fort Worth, TX (182.8 miles , pop. 534,694)
Nearest city with pop. 1,000,000+: San Antonio, TX (199.0 miles , pop. 1,144,646)
Nearest cities: Robert Lee, TX (3.3 miles ), Blackwell, TX (3.7 miles ), Winters, TX (4.5 miles ), Blackwell-Nolan, TX (4.6 miles ), Miles, TX (4.6 miles ), Ballinger, TX (4.7 miles ), Rowena, TX (5.0 miles ), Grape Creek, TX (5.1 miles )
Bronte Compared to State Average: Median house value below state average. Unemployed percentage below state average. Black race population percentage significantly below state average. Hispanic race population percentage significantly above state average. Foreign-born population percentage below state average. Institutionalized population percentage above state average. Number of college students significantly below state average.
BRONTE, TEXAS EDUCATION FACTSHigh school or higher: 73.30%
Bachelor’s degree or higher: 16.10%
Graduate or professional degree: 3.80%
